On-highway Vehicle Lighting Market Size

The global on-highway vehicle lighting market size was valued at USD 31.32 billion in 2024, and it is projected to grow from USD 32.92 billion in 2025 to reach USD 49.01 billion by 2033, exhibiting a CAGR of 5.1% during the forecast period (2025-2033). 

The global market covers the design, manufacturing, and sale of lighting systems used in vehicles that operate primarily on public roads, such as cars, trucks, and buses. These lighting systems include headlights, taillights, fog lights, and interior lights, playing a crucial role in vehicle safety, visibility, and aesthetics. The market is driven by rising vehicle production, technological advancements in LED and adaptive lighting, and increasing regulatory emphasis on road safety. Additionally, consumer demand for advanced lighting designs and energy-efficient solutions contributes to the market's evolution.

Latest Market Trend

Increased adoption of LED lighting

The adoption of LED lighting in on-highway vehicles has expanded rapidly due to its superior benefits over traditional halogen and HID systems. LEDs offer enhanced energy efficiency, consuming significantly less power while delivering higher illumination, which translates to better road visibility and improved safety. Their longer lifespan reduces the need for frequent replacements, which is especially valuable for commercial fleets. Moreover, as automotive design trends move toward futuristic aesthetics, LED technology allows for sleek, customizable lighting profiles, enabling automakers to differentiate their models visually.

  • For instancein March 2024, KOITO MANUFACTURING CO., LTD. commenced operations at its Gujarat Plant in India to meet the growing demand for advanced automotive lighting, including LED systems.This strategic move aims to enhance production capacity for clients such as Maruti Suzuki India and Tata Motors.

On-highway Vehicle Lighting Market Growth Factor

Stringent government regulations on road safety

Governments worldwide are increasingly enforcing stringent road safety regulations to curb the rising number of traffic accidents, many of which are caused by poor lighting and limited nighttime visibility. These regulations are compelling vehicle manufacturers to integrate advanced lighting systems such as Adaptive Front-lighting Systems (AFS), Daytime Running Lights (DRLs), automatic high-beam controls, and LED headlamps. Such systems improve nighttime driving conditions, adapt lighting to traffic and road environments, and reduce glare for oncoming drivers. Compliance with safety norms such as those from the UN Economic Commission for Europe (UNECE) and the National Highway Traffic Safety Administration (NHTSA) is now a critical factor in automotive design.

  • For example,in May 2024, ams OSRAM showcased its latest sensing and illumination solutions at the Automotive Engineering Exposition in Yokohama, Japan. These innovations include intelligent LED technologies designed to meet evolving safety standards and enhance vehicle visibility. 

Market Restraint

High initial costs and complex integration

Despite the positive growth trajectory, the market faces challenges related to the high initial costs and complex integration of advanced lighting technologies. Innovative systems, such as adaptive and LED lighting, involve substantial research and development expenses, leading to higher production costs. These costs are often passed on to consumers, making vehicles equipped with such technologies less affordable, particularly in price-sensitive markets.

Additionally, integrating sophisticated lighting systems with existing vehicle electronics and control units can be complex and require significant modifications. This complexity can deter manufacturers from adopting new lighting technologies, especially in regions where cost constraints are an essential consideration. Addressing these challenges requires ongoing efforts to reduce production costs and develop standardized integration processes to facilitate broader adoption of advanced vehicle lighting systems.

Market Opportunity

Growing demand for smart lighting solutions

A significant opportunity for growth lies in adopting intelligent, connected, and adaptive lighting technologies. Smart lighting systems improve aesthetics and visibility and contribute significantly to autonomous vehicle safety and communication. These systems can adjust beam patterns based on real-time traffic, detect pedestrians or oncoming vehicles, and even signal intentions through lighting cues. Additionally, integration with IoT and vehicle-to-everything (V2X) communication allows lighting systems to interact with other vehicles and infrastructure, further improving safety and navigation. The rising development and adoption of electric and autonomous cars globally are accelerating the demand for these next-generation lighting solutions. Vehicle manufacturers are increasingly partnering with tech companies to co-develop lighting modules embedded with AI and advanced sensor systems.

  • For instance, in June 2024, ams OSRAM developed the ALIYOS Mini LED taillight, featuring flexible arrangements and block-based light control.This innovation enables the dynamic display of symbols and messages, enhancing style and communication on the road.

Regional Insights

Asia-Pacific: Dominant region with 53% market share

Asia-Pacific led the global market in 2024 with over 53% revenue share and is projected to remain the dominant region throughout the forecast period. Rapid industrialization, rising income levels, and expanding vehicle ownership in countries like China, India, and South Korea are primary contributors. Government policies favoring energy-efficient and safety-enhancing automotive technologies are accelerating LED adoption. Moreover, Asia Pacific is home to major automotive manufacturing hubs and global suppliers of lighting systems, allowing for faster and more cost-effective implementation of innovations. The region’s high population density and growing urban infrastructure also contribute to the need for enhanced road safety features, further boosting demand for premium lighting systems.

Europe: Fastest-growing region with high market CAGR

Europe is expected to register the fastest CAGR during the forecast period, thanks to strict regulatory mandates and high demand for premium and luxury vehicles. Countries like Germany, the UK, and France are pioneering automotive innovation, particularly in adaptive lighting, LED matrix systems, and laser headlamps. Europe's focus on road safety, emission standards, and energy efficiency has created a favorable environment for technological advancements in vehicle lighting. Automakers such as Audi, BMW, and Mercedes-Benz continue to set benchmarks for advanced headlight technologies. The widespread presence of Tier 1 suppliers and R&D centers further cements Europe's leadership in high-performance lighting systems.

Countrywise Insights

The global market is influenced by country-specific trends that reflect local manufacturing capabilities, regulatory environments, and consumer preferences.

  • The U.S.: The U.S. market thrives on stringent NHTSA safety mandates and a tech-savvy consumer base that demands high-performance lighting. OEMs continue integrating adaptive lighting and advanced LED solutions across models, driven by competition and evolving safety norms. Additionally, the popularity of SUVs and pickup trucks in the U.S. has heightened the need for high-intensity, durable lighting systems.
  • Canada: Canada's longstanding mandate for Daytime Running Lights (DRLs) and harsh winter conditions have increased the importance of reliable and efficient lighting systems. Automakers cater to these requirements by enhancing headlight brightness and integrating intelligent lighting technologies. The country's extended dark winter months create a sustained demand for fog lights, high-beam assist, and heated lighting units to prevent ice build-up.
  • Japan: With a mature automotive market and a high focus on innovation, Japan remains a major adopter of adaptive LED systems and automatic high-beam features. Brands such as Toyota, Nissan, and Honda lead with futuristic lighting integration in electric and hybrid vehicles, including matrix LED and intelligent cornering lights. Japan's consumer preference for technologically advanced yet compact vehicles further drives innovation in efficient, multi-functional lighting units that fit seamlessly within modern car designs.
  • India: India is emerging as a significant market for on-highway lighting due to rising car sales, better road networks, and increasing adoption of safety standards like AIS-048 for lighting devices. Budget cars are now equipped with LED DRLs and projector lamps, which were once considered premium features.
  • China: China is rapidly adopting energy-efficient LED lighting and developing smart, connected vehicle systems. Government policies and incentives for EVs have further propelled demand for modern, low-power lighting. Urban centers also enforce stricter emissions and visibility standards, pushing domestic and foreign manufacturers to equip vehicles with state-of-the-art adaptive and laser-based headlamp systems.
  • UK: The UK’s strong luxury vehicle market and focus on premium features have created a surge in adaptive lighting and dynamic signal systems. Recent bans on HID xenon retrofits have accelerated the shift to compliant LED systems. British consumers favor elegant vehicle aesthetics, prompting carmakers to emphasize sleek, futuristic headlight and taillight designs.
  • Germany: Germany leads with automotive giants like Audi, BMW, and Mercedes, pushing the envelope in lighting technology. Innovations such as OLED tail lights and laser headlights are being commercialized, setting global standards in design and performance. The country’s extensive R&D capabilities and tight safety regulations have made it a testing ground for futuristic vehicle lighting, including digital light projections and adaptive beam shaping.

Segmentation Analysis

By Product

The LED segment continues to dominate the global on-highway vehicle lighting market, capturing around 43.2% of the total market share in 2024. This dominance is attributed to several advantages of LEDs, such as superior energy efficiency, longer operational lifespan, reduced maintenance costs, and enhanced brightness. LEDs offer immediate illumination, making them ideal for safety and styling. Their adaptability allows automakers to design distinctive lighting signatures that help brands stand out. Additionally, LEDs are increasingly used in interior ambient lighting, fog lamps, and exterior styling elements, adding to their widespread appeal.

By Application

The headlight segment accounted for over 56% of the market share in 2024 and is projected to maintain its lead throughout the forecast period. Headlights remain the cornerstone of automotive safety and design, with continuous innovation in laser, LED, and adaptive front lighting systems driving demand. Consumers increasingly seek improved night visibility and safer driving conditions, prompting manufacturers to adopt more innovative headlight technologies. In addition to safety, style also plays a role—sleek, high-performance headlamps enhance a vehicle’s aesthetic appeal.

By Vehicle Type

The passenger car segment emerged as the highest revenue generator in 2024, accounting for over 44.2% of the total share. This trend is driven by the growing global vehicle fleet, rising urbanization, and increasing disposable income across developing regions. The surge in demand for stylish and feature-rich cars pushes automakers to incorporate innovative lighting solutions to differentiate their offerings. LED and adaptive lighting systems are becoming standard in mid-range and even entry-level cars, spurred by consumer expectations and regulatory standards.
